I have a 2002 John Deere 4710 with a Tilt Steering Wheel which I need to remove. I have tried several techniques which have all been unsuccessful. Has anyone out there have a method that works?

Welcome from Tennessee. I removed my steering wheel off my Massey Ferguson 135 with only a rubber mallet. I would hit upwards on a spoke, turn the wheel hit another, roll the wheel hit another. Of coarse do with with the retainer nut removed. It came loose after about ten to twenty wacks. You are basically rocking it ever so slightly on the steering shaft using this method. Be patient though it will come loose.
